Please help me to debug this programme

richipearl
richipearl over 6 years ago

I wrote the following code to make a seven digit segment display number from 1 to 9 continuously but while compiling the arduino ide write error, too many argument  to function turnOn

 

 

byte ledPin[7]={2,3,4,5,6,8,9};

#define buttonPin 11

int no = 0;

int pushButton = 0;

void setup() {

  for(int a = 0;a < 7;a++){

  pinMode(ledPin[a],OUTPUT);

  }

  pinMode(buttonPin,INPUT_PULLUP);

  turnOn();

}

  // put your setup code here, to run once:

 

void turnOn()

{ 

  pushButton = digitalRead(buttonPin);

 

  {

    if (pushButton == LOW)

    no++;

    delay(200);

  }

{

switch(no)

  {

    case 1:

      digitalWrite(ledPin[0],LOW);

      digitalWrite(ledPin[1],HIGH);

      digitalWrite(ledPin[2],HIGH);

      digitalWrite(ledPin[3],LOW);

      digitalWrite(ledPin[4],LOW);

      digitalWrite(ledPin[5],LOW);

      digitalWrite(ledPin[6],LOW);

      break;

    case 2:

     digitalWrite(ledPin[0],HIGH);

     digitalWrite(ledPin[1],LOW);

     digitalWrite(ledPin[2],HIGH);

     digitalWrite(ledPin[3],HIGH);

     digitalWrite(ledPin[4],HIGH);

     digitalWrite(ledPin[5],HIGH);

     digitalWrite(ledPin[6],LOW);

     break;

    case 3:

      digitalWrite(ledPin[0],HIGH);

      digitalWrite(ledPin[1],HIGH);

      digitalWrite(ledPin[2],HIGH);

      digitalWrite(ledPin[3],HIGH);

      digitalWrite(ledPin[4],LOW);

      digitalWrite(ledPin[5],HIGH);

      digitalWrite(ledPin[6],LOW);

      break;

    case 4:

    digitalWrite(ledPin[0],LOW);

    digitalWrite(ledPin[1],HIGH);

    digitalWrite(ledPin[2],HIGH);

    digitalWrite(ledPin[3],LOW);

    digitalWrite(ledPin[4],LOW);

    digitalWrite(ledPin[5],HIGH);

    digitalWrite(ledPin[6],HIGH);

    break;

   case 5:

   digitalWrite(ledPin[0],HIGH);

   digitalWrite(ledPin[1],HIGH);

   digitalWrite(ledPin[2],LOW);

   digitalWrite(ledPin[3],HIGH);

   digitalWrite(ledPin[4],LOW);

   digitalWrite(ledPin[5],HIGH);

   digitalWrite(ledPin[6],LOW);

   break;

  case 6:

    digitalWrite(ledPin[0],HIGH);

    digitalWrite(ledPin[1],HIGH);

    digitalWrite(ledPin[2],LOW);

    digitalWrite(ledPin[3],HIGH);

    digitalWrite(ledPin[4],HIGH);

    digitalWrite(ledPin[5],HIGH);

    digitalWrite(ledPin[6],HIGH);

    break;

  case 7:

    digitalWrite(ledPin[0],HIGH);

    digitalWrite(ledPin[1],HIGH);

    digitalWrite(ledPin[2],HIGH);

    digitalWrite(ledPin[3],LOW);

    digitalWrite(ledPin[4],LOW);

    digitalWrite(ledPin[5],LOW);

    digitalWrite(ledPin[6],LOW);

    break;

  case 8:

      digitalWrite(ledPin[0],HIGH);

      digitalWrite(ledPin[1],HIGH);

      digitalWrite(ledPin[2],HIGH);

      digitalWrite(ledPin[3],HIGH);

      digitalWrite(ledPin[4],HIGH);

      digitalWrite(ledPin[5],HIGH);

      digitalWrite(ledPin[6],HIGH);

      break;

  case 9:

    digitalWrite(ledPin[0],HIGH);

    digitalWrite(ledPin[1],HIGH);

    digitalWrite(ledPin[2],HIGH);

    digitalWrite(ledPin[3],HIGH);

    digitalWrite(ledPin[4],LOW);

    digitalWrite(ledPin[5],HIGH);

    digitalWrite(ledPin[6],HIGH);

    break;

    }

    }

}

void loop()

{

  for (int b = 0;b < 10;b++)

  {

    turnOn(b);

    delay(500);   

  }

 

  }

 

 

// put your main code here, to run repeated

    Fred27 over 6 years ago in reply to richipearl +5 suggested
    There's not a huge amount the explain. Only one line needs to change. turnOn(b); need to become turnOn(); void loop() { for (int b = 0;b < 10;b++) { turnOn(); delay(500); } } Of course, once it compiles…
  • Jan Cumps
    Jan Cumps over 6 years ago +4 suggested
    your turnOn() function expects 0 parameters, but you pass it 1 parameter: turnOn(b)
